What Causes Mold Damage?
Understanding the root cause of mold damage can help you prevent it in the future. Mold thrives in moist environments, and common causes include:
Water Leaks
Leaking pipes, roofs, or appliances create ideal conditions for mold.
Flooding
Storms and natural disasters can lead to severe water damage and mold growth.
High Humidity
Indoor humidity above 50% encourages mold development.
Poor Ventilation
Lack of airflow traps moisture, especially in bathrooms and kitchens.
Condensation
Moisture buildup on windows, walls, and pipes can lead to hidden mold.

The Mold Damage Restoration Process
Professional mold damage restoration services follow a structured process to ensure complete recovery:
1. Inspection and Assessment
Experts assess the extent of mold damage and identify the source of moisture.
2. Containment
The affected area is sealed to prevent mold spores from spreading.
3. Air Filtration
HEPA filtration systems remove airborne mold particles.
4. Mold Removal
Specialized tools and cleaning solutions are used to eliminate mold safely.
5. Water Damage Repair
Leaks and moisture issues are fixed to prevent recurrence.
6. Cleaning and Sanitizing
All surfaces are disinfected to remove bacteria and odors.
7. Restoration and Repairs
Damaged materials like drywall, flooring, or insulation are repaired or replaced.

How to Prevent Mold Damage in the Future
Preventing mold growth is key to maintaining a healthy home.
Control Humidity
Keep indoor humidity below 50% using dehumidifiers.
Fix Leaks Immediately
Repair plumbing or roof leaks as soon as they occur.
Improve Ventilation
Use exhaust fans and ensure proper airflow.
Regular Inspections
Check for signs of moisture or mold regularly.
Use Mold-Resistant Materials
Install mold-resistant drywall and paint in moisture-prone areas.
Keep Areas Dry
Dry wet surfaces within 24–48 hours.
